Is this retreat right for me if my grief is still very present?

Yes. This retreat is specifically designed for women whose grief is still alive and tender. You do not need to be “finished” with your grief—or even feel hopeful—to attend. You only need a willingness to show up as you are.

Will I be required to share my story in a group?

No. Sharing is always invitational, never required. You are encouraged to participate at your own pace and comfort level. Silence, reflection, and private processing are fully respected.

Is this therapy?

This retreat is therapeutic and clinically informed, but it is not group therapy. It blends mindfulness, experiential practices, and therapeutic guidance in a retreat setting—offering depth, support, and safety without pressure or diagnosis.

What kinds of losses does this retreat support?

This retreat welcomes grief in many forms, including:

  • Death of a loved one

  • Divorce or relationship loss

  • Loss of identity, health, or life direction

  • Empty nest or life-stage transitions

  • Ambiguous or unrecognized losses

You do not need to justify or explain your grief for it to be valid here.

What if I become emotional or overwhelmed?

Strong emotions are a natural part of grief and healing. This retreat is facilitated by experienced therapists who are attuned to emotional safety and nervous system regulation. Support, grounding, and choice are always available.

Will this retreat be heavy or depressing?

While grief is honored, the retreat is not heavy or bleak. Alongside grief, there is space for warmth, laughter, connection, beauty, and joy. Many women describe the experience as deeply moving, grounding, and quietly uplifting.

What should I expect over the weekend?

Expect a gentle pace, time in nature, guided mindfulness, experiential therapeutic exercises, small-group connection, nourishing meals, and space for rest and reflection. You’ll be encouraged to listen to your needs throughout.

Do I need experience with meditation or mindfulness?

Not at all. All practices are guided and accessible, whether you are new to mindfulness or have an established practice.
